  1.1                          A bill for an act 
  1.2             appropriating money for Landfall housing and 
  1.3             redevelopment. 
  1.4   B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F MINNESOTA: 
  1.5      Section 1.  [PURPOSE, FINDINGS.] 
  1.6      The legislature finds that: 
  1.7      (1) providing a sufficient supply of adequate, safe, and 
  1.8   sanitary dwellings and remedying the shortage of housing for low-
  1.9   and moderate-income residents are necessary functions of 
  1.10  government in order to protect the public health, safety, and 
  1.11  general welfare of the citizens of this state; 
  1.12     (2) obtaining and securing affordable housing in the 
  1.13  metropolitan area and providing a mix of housing opportunities 
  1.14  for low- and moderate-income persons promotes and secures these 
  1.15  public purposes; 
  1.16     (3) encouraging homeownership opportunities for low- and 
  1.17  moderate-income persons in the metropolitan area, by reasonable 
  1.18  means and with cooperation of state and local government, will 
  1.19  contribute to a stronger tax base upon which the state and its 
  1.20  political subdivisions depend for the financing of other 
  1.21  governmental functions and attract and secure additional 
  1.22  employment; 
  1.23     (4) the city of Landfall has vigorously promoted its 
  1.24  policies of providing low- and moderate-income housing, and 
  2.1   state assistance to the city for the purposes of purchasing the 
  2.2   real property where the low- and moderate-income housing is 
  2.3   sited, in order to secure and retain housing for low- and 
  2.4   moderate-income persons, would further the aforementioned public 
  2.5   purposes and enhance the ability of Washington county to secure 
  2.6   and obtain low- and moderate-income housing in other areas of 
  2.7   the county; and 
  2.8      (5) it is therefore necessary for the public health, 
  2.9   safety, and general welfare for the state to assist in the 
  2.10  financing of low- and moderate-income homeownership in the city 
  2.11  of Landfall by authorizing financing and other reasonable 
  2.12  arrangements as may be necessary to accomplish that purpose. 
  2.13     Sec. 2.  [APPROPRIATION.] 
  2.14     $....... is appropriated to the city of Landfall or its 
  2.15  housing and redevelopment authority from the general fund for 
  2.16  purchase of the portion of real property in the city owned by 
  2.17  the Washington county housing and redevelopment authority.  This 
  2.18  appropriation may not be made until the city of Landfall and the 
  2.19  Washington county housing and redevelopment authority provide 
  2.20  agreements satisfactory to the commissioner of revenue for 
  2.21  contributions for the purposes of the purchase in the amounts of 
  2.22  $....... from the city of Landfall and $....... from the 
  2.23  Washington county housing and redevelopment authority.  The 
  2.24  appropriation is available for the biennium ending June 30, 1997.
